#4b63c5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4b63c5 is composed of 29.4% red, 38.8% green and 77.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.9% cyan, 49.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 228.2 degrees, a saturation of 51.3% and a lightness of 53.3%. #4b63c5 color hex could be obtained by blending #96c6ff with #00008b.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

Shades and Tints of #4b63c5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#04060d is the darkest color, while #fdfdfe is the lightest one.
